1. Safety Information
Please read all instructions carefully before installing and operating your Jensen J4W12 subwoofer. Failure to follow these instructions may result in serious injury or damage to the product or vehicle.
- Always disconnect the vehicle's negative battery terminal before beginning any electrical work.
- Ensure all wiring is properly insulated and secured to prevent short circuits and damage.
- Avoid installing the subwoofer in locations where it may be exposed to moisture or excessive heat.
- Professional installation is recommended for optimal performance and safety.
- Do not operate the subwoofer at excessively high volumes for prolonged periods, as this may cause hearing damage.

5. Operating Instructions
Once installed, follow these steps to operate your subwoofer and integrate it with your car audio system.
- Initial Power-Up: After installation, turn on your car audio system. Start with the amplifier gain and head unit volume at their lowest settings.
- Adjusting Gain: Gradually increase the amplifier gain until you achieve the desired bass level without distortion. Avoid setting the gain too high, as this can lead to clipping and damage.
- Crossover Settings: Use your amplifier's or head unit's crossover settings to filter out high frequencies from the subwoofer, allowing it to reproduce only the low-frequency sounds it's designed for. A typical low-pass filter setting for a subwoofer is between 80Hz and 120Hz.
- Phase Control: Experiment with the phase switch (0° or 180°) on your amplifier to find the setting that provides the most impactful and cohesive bass response with your other speakers.

7.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your Jensen J4W12 subwoofer, refer to the following troubleshooting guide:
7.1 No Sound from Subwoofer
- Check Power: Ensure the amplifier is receiving power and its power indicator light is on. Check the fuse on the amplifier and in the vehicle's power line.
- Check Connections: Verify all wiring connections (power, ground, remote, RCA, speaker wires) are secure and correctly connected.
- Amplifier Settings: Confirm the amplifier's gain is not set to minimum, and the crossover is correctly configured (e.g., LPF enabled).
- Head Unit Output: Ensure the head unit is sending an audio signal to the amplifier (check RCA connections and head unit settings).
7.2 Distorted or Weak Bass
- Gain Setting: Reduce the amplifier's gain if the sound is distorted. If the bass is weak, gradually increase the gain.
- Crossover Adjustment: Adjust the low-pass filter (LPF) on your amplifier or head unit. If the LPF is set too high, the subwoofer may play frequencies it's not designed for, causing distortion.
- Phase Setting: Try switching the phase (0° or 180°) on your amplifier. Incorrect phase can cause bass cancellation.
- Enclosure Integrity: Check the subwoofer enclosure for any air leaks or damage, which can negatively impact bass performance.
- Power Supply: Ensure your vehicle's electrical system can adequately supply power to the amplifier. A weak power supply can lead to weak or distorted bass.
8. Specifications
Detailed technical specifications for the Jensen J4W12 12-inch Subwoofer:
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model Number | J4W12 |
| Brand | Jensen |
| Subwoofer Size | 12 inches |
| Peak Power | 1200 Watts |
| RMS Power | 300 Watts |
| Impedance | 4 Ohms |
| Woofer Cone Material | Polypropylene |
| Surround Material | Double Stitched Rubber Injected |
| Basket Design | Low Resonance, Steel Stamped Reinforced |
| Connectivity Technology | Wired |
| Special Feature | Bass Boost |
| Product Dimensions | 11 x 11 x 5.75 inches |
| Item Weight | 10.32 pounds |
| Color | Blue |
| UPC | 827204121863 |
